在现代社会中,电子支付和各种移动支付工具已经成为人们日常生活不可或缺的一部分。_im2.0_作为其中一种流行的移...
在区块链和加密货币的世界中,消息签名的验证是一个至关重要的安全措施。imToken作为一款流行的数字资产钱包应用,其不仅提供了安全的资产存储,还提供了消息签名和验证功能。接下来,我们将探讨如何在imToken中验证消息签名的具体步骤、背后的原理以及相关的最佳实践。
消息签名是一种加密技术,用于验证某条消息的真实性和完整性。通过公钥密码学,签名可以确认消息确实由声称的发送者所发,并且在传输过程中没有被篡改。具体而言,发送者使用其私钥对消息进行签名,而接收者则使用发送者的公钥进行验证。
以imToken为例,用户在进行交易或与他人交流时,常常需要确保信息的可靠性和安全性。此时,消息签名就显得尤为重要,它可以有效地防止信息被伪造或篡改。
在imToken中,消息签名和验证的过程大致可以分为以下几个步骤:
以下是具体的验证步骤:
收件人在验证消息签名之前,首先需要获取发件人的公钥。这可以通过多种方式实现,比如直接询问发件人,或通过区块链地址的公开信息获取。
收件人需要从接收到的消息中提取出原消息内容和签名。这些信息通常是一起发送的,所以需确保签名与对应的原消息一致。
在imToken中,用户可以通过内置的签名验证功能来进行验证。用户只需输入提取的原消息和签名,并选择对应的公钥。应用会自动执行验证过程。
若消息通过验证,imToken会显示验证成功的信息;若未通过,系统会提示用户,该消息可能被篡改。此时,用户应谨慎对待后续操作。
在实践中,用户在进行消息签名验证时,可能会遇到以下几种
在消息签名验证中,公钥的真实性至关重要。为了避免中间人攻击,用户应该通过受信任的渠道来获取公钥。当用户需要向他人索取公钥时,可以通过面对面的方式,或使用其他加密手段,确保所获得的公钥是发件人的真实公钥。此外,用户还可参考一些第三方认证服务来验证公钥的真实性,这种服务能有效减轻用户的信任顾虑,确保信息传输的安全。
如果用户在imToken中验证消息签名时出现失败的情况,首先应保持冷静,并对结果进行分析。可能导致签名验证失败的原因有多种,例如数据被篡改,签名格式不正确,或公钥不匹配。用户应回头检查接收到的消息,确保消息内容与签名是一一对应的。如果依然无法解决问题,建议联系发件人进行确认,确保所有信息准确无误,并在必要时采取进一步的措施来保护个人信息与资产。
在imToken中,私钥的安全问题始终是用户最关心的事项之一。imToken采用多重加密技术来保障私钥的安全,并将私钥保存在用户本地设备中,绝不会上传至服务器。此外,用户还可以设置密码等验证方式,以进一步保护钱包内的数字资产和私钥。我们建议用户选择强密码,并定期更新,同时保持设备的安全与私密。
为了进一步提高消息签名的安全性,用户可以采取一些额外的措施。首先,要确保私钥从未泄露,定期检查公钥的使用情况。其次,使用最新版本的imToken,确保所有安全补丁及功能正常运作。此外,进行重要操作时,可以考虑使用多签名钱包,以增加一层安全保护。用户还可以利用临时公钥签名机制,为敏感操作设立短期有效的公钥,减少潜在的攻击面。
消息签名的验证在imToken及更广泛的区块链应用中扮演着重要角色。通过了解其如何运作以及如何在具体场景中进行应用,用户能够有效提高其交易和信息交流的安全性。在未来,随着区块链技术的不断发展,消息签名和验证的机制也将持续演进,因此用户需保持对这一主题的关注,以保护自身的资产和信息安全。